
You can now create, share AI-generated image as WhatsApp status
What's the story
WhatsApp has launched a new feature, powered by Meta's advanced generative technology, to create and share custom AI-generated visuals as status updates. The innovative tool works by turning simple text prompts into creative, shareable images within the app. The feature is currently being rolled out to select users on both iOS and Android platforms.
User guide
How to create AI images for WhatsApp status
To use this feature, users have to go to the Updates tab and tap on "AI Images" while creating a new status. They can then type a prompt describing what they want the image to depict, like "a dreamy sunset over the sea" or "cyberpunk city at dusk." Meta AI will generate several variations of the requested scene, which users can scroll through and select from.

Availability and rollout
The AI image generation facility for status updates is currently available to a subset of users who have installed the latest WhatsApp versions. It is being tested in select regions before a broader release. Some users may see the feature immediately, while others may have to wait for their app to receive a server-side update.
